Making Steps : Open your parcel, check the kits whether all the parts are complete or not. Check the resin diamonds color and the corresponding color code, ensure all the diamonds code are complete. Open a small part of the adhesive tape, pay attention to keep dust out. Select a character (symbol), find the corresponding diamonds and put it into the drill plate.
